92nd MSG gains new commander

Col. Yvonne Spencer assumed command of the 92nd Mission Support Group from Col. David Stookey during a ceremony here July 14.

Spencer joins Team Fairchild after serving as commander of the 819th RED HORSE Squadron at Malmstrom AFB, Montana.

Spencer commissioned in 1994 at the U.S. Air Force Academy in Colorado Springs, Colorado, where she earned a Bachelor of Science in Engineering Mechanics.

She also holds a Master of Science in Environmental and Engineering Management from the Air Force Institute of Technology at Wright-Patterson AFB, Ohio.

Her decorations include a Bronze Star, a Meritorious Service Medal with silver oak leaf cluster, a Joint Service Commendation Medal, an Air Force Commendation Medal with bronze oak leaf cluster and an Air Force Achievement Medal.

The 92nd ARW commander, Col. Brian McDaniel, was the officiating officer for the ceremony.
